Changes in Store for barismo's Arlington Space

Photo: Facebook/barismo

Changes are afoot for barismo, an Arlington-based coffee roaster that also has a coffee shop, dwelltime, in Cambridge. barismo is currently in the process of moving its roasting operations from Arlington over to Somerville's Union Square, in the new Aeronaut Brewing Company space, and as a result, the Arlington space will be revamped into something more like dwelltime. It'll get a new name as well, but contrary to what an April Fool's Day blog post from the company announced, it will not be dwelltime's Too, The Refined Pallet (reflecting a "love for reclaimed pallet wood that the coffee comes delivered on"), or swell time, although the latter is kind of fun.

Meanwhile, the new Somerville space will represent a return to the early days of barismo, a place where customers could come in and buy beans, learn about roasting, and chat about coffee. (It's not a coffee shop; you can't just go in and have a drink prepared.) "We want to get back to an experience where you can pick our brains and really get to as deep a level as you want to go about your coffee," writes barismo's Tim Borrego in a recent blog post. There will be tastings, events, classes, and more. "We hope to host a lot of serious coffee industry events and gatherings for the coffee community," writes Borrego. "Surely the lure of Somerville's new brewery can get even the most stubborn barista to come out to the space."
